I T HAD all the hallmarks of a great marriage _ mutual attraction and admiration, plus a willingness to co-operate and plan a future together _ and yet the partnership of PGG Wrightson and Silver Fern Farms may be headed on to the rocks.

In June last year NZX-listed rural services business PGG Wrightson agreed to buy half of meat-processor co-operative Silver Fern Farms for $220 million.

The deal was promoted as creating a supply chain stretching from pasture to plate and a platform for industry rationalisation, with prospective short- and long-term gains of more than $60 million and up to $110 million a year respectively.
